Overview

The Lava Yuva 5G is a budget-tier 5G [smartphone](/trend/best-smartphones-2026/) featuring a Unisoc T750 chipset for affordable next-gen connectivity and a 5000 mAh battery for multi-day reliability, aimed at cost-conscious families and first-time smartphone users. Released in mid-2024, it competes with entry-level offerings from brands like Redmi and Realme by focusing on providing high-speed network access at a price floor previously reserved for 4G devices.

Software That Does Not Confuse the Seniors


Operating on Android 13, the user interface stays close to the stock experience, which is a blessing for families. Many budget competitors clutter their screens with "bloatware"—unnecessary apps that slow down the system and confuse less tech-savvy users. This model avoids most of those pitfalls, offering a clean layout that makes finding the phone app or camera straightforward. The 90Hz refresh rate on the display further enhances the experience, making animations feel fluid rather than stuttery.

We found that the Unisoc T750 processor, built on a 6nm process, handles the UI with surprising grace. Unlike older 12nm chips found in previous budget generations, this 6nm architecture is more power-efficient and runs cooler. This means that even after an hour of video calling Grandma, the back of the phone doesn't become uncomfortably hot. The inclusion of two high-performance Cortex-A76 cores ensures that apps open without the agonizing five-second delay common in ultra-low-end hardware.

While 4GB of RAM might sound modest, the use of UFS 2.2 storage is the real hero here. Most phones at this price point use slower eMMC storage, which acts like a bottleneck. UFS 2.2 allows for much faster read/write speeds, meaning system updates install quicker and the phone remains responsive even as the 64GB or 128GB storage fills up with family photos and school documents.

Where the Corners Were Cut


No device at this price point is without its compromises, and we must be honest about where they are. First, the lack of NFC (Near Field Communication) is a missed opportunity. As digital payments become more common, even in budget segments, the inability to tap-to-pay might be a deal-breaker for urban commuters. If your daily routine involves contactless transit or grocery payments, you will need to keep your physical wallet handy.

The second major hurdle is the 720p display resolution. While we defended it for battery efficiency, there is no denying that text looks slightly softer and high-definition videos lack the crispness found on 1080p screens. At 269 ppi, it is perfectly functional for WhatsApp and Facebook, but users who spend hours watching Netflix might notice the lack of detail in darker scenes.

Finally, the camera system is basic. The 50 MP main sensor is great for well-lit outdoor shots and documenting homework assignments, but it struggles significantly in low light. The secondary 2 MP macro sensor is largely decorative. For parents hoping to capture crisp photos of kids playing sports indoors, the shutter lag and lack of advanced stabilization will prove frustrating. This is a camera for memories, not for photography enthusiasts.

The Two-Day Endurance King


The 5000 mAh battery is the undisputed heart of this handset. In a world where we are increasingly tethered to power banks, the ability to go two days on a single charge with moderate use is a luxury. For a student who might be at school all day and then at sports practice, this phone eliminates "battery anxiety." You can trust it to have enough juice for that "I'm heading home" call at 8:00 PM.

Efficiency is the name of the game here. The combination of a low-resolution screen, a 6nm power-efficient chipset, and a large battery creates a synergy that few other phones in the 110 EUR range can match. Even when using 5G networks, which are notoriously power-hungry, the drain is manageable. This makes it an excellent choice for rural areas where signal searching can often kill a smaller battery in hours.

While the 18W wired charging speed is slow by modern standards, we view this through the lens of longevity. Fast charging at 67W or 100W generates significant heat, which degrades lithium-polymer batteries over time. By sticking to 18W, the manufacturer has prioritized a battery that will still hold a strong charge two years from now, which is exactly what a value hunter looks for.

Technical Specifications

LAUNCH
Announced 2024, March 30
Status Available. Released 2024, June 06
PLATFORM
OS Android 13
Chipset Unisoc T750 (6 nm)
CPU Octa-core (2x2.0 GHz Cortex-A76 & 6x1.8 GHz Cortex-A55)
GPU Mali-G57 MC2
BODY
Dimensions 163.4 x 76.2 x 9.1 mm (6.43 x 3.00 x 0.36 in)
Weight 208 g (7.34 oz)
SIM Nano-SIM + Nano-SIM
DISPLAY
Type IPS LCD, 90Hz
Size 6.53 inches, 102.9 cm2 (~82.7% screen-to-body ratio)
Resolution 720 x 1600 pixels, 20:9 ratio (~269 ppi density)
MEMORY
Card slot microSDXC
Internal 64GB 4GB RAM, 128GB 4GB RAM
Info UFS 2.2
MAIN CAMERA
Dual 50 MP, (wide), AF
2 MP (macro)
Features LED flash, HDR, panorama
Video 1080p@30fps
SELFIE CAMERA
Single 8 MP
Video 1080p@30fps
SOUND
Loudspeaker Yes
3.5mm jack Yes
COMMS
WLAN Wi-Fi 802.11 b/g/n/ac
Bluetooth 5.0, A2DP, LE
Positioning GPS
NFC No
Radio FM radio
USB USB Type-C 2.0, OTG
NETWORK
Technology GSM / HSPA / LTE / 5G
2G bands GSM 900 / 1800
3G bands HSDPA 900 / 2100
4G bands 1, 3, 5, 8, 28, 40, 41
5G bands 1, 3, 5, 8, 28, 40, 77, 78 SA/NSA
Speed HSPA, LTE, 5G
FEATURES
Sensors Fingerprint (side-mounted), accelerometer, proximity, compass
BATTERY
Type Li-Po 5000 mAh
Charging 18W wired
